CNC Machinist - 2nd Shift
Location : East Syracuse, NY
Pay : $24.00 - $29.00 per hour (plus 10% shift differential)
Shift : 2nd Shift (3:00 PM - 11:30 PM)
Summary : We are seeking an experienced CNC Machinist to join our team on 2nd shift. This role is responsible for producing precision machined parts by setting up and operating CNC milling machines while maintaining quality and safety standards.
Key Responsibilities
Set up and operate multi-axis CNC milling machines using blueprints or process sheets.
Obtain first-piece approval from quality inspection.
Perform in-process inspections using micrometers, calipers, and other precision tools.
Diagnose and troubleshoot machining issues; monitor tooling for wear and replace as needed.
Plan machining operations by interpreting work orders, blueprints, and GD&T specifications.
Enter machine instructions, set tool registers, offsets, and prove part programs.
Maintain equipment through preventive maintenance and troubleshooting.
Document production and quality logs; communicate shift updates.
Train other CNC machinists as needed.
Adhere to all safety policies and maintain a clean work environment.
Qualifications
High school diploma or technical school equivalent.
Minimum 2 years of experience setting up and operating CNC vertical and horizontal machining centers.
Ability to read blueprints and use precision measuring instruments.
Strong attention to detail and problem-solving skills.
